DESCRIPTION:Pōneke Rockers Sea Mouse are back on the road this November. The four date tour announcement comes in anticipation of their upcoming third album ‘Dance Tunnel’. The trio have released three singles off the forthcoming album including Gearbox\, Weed Whacker\, and Sold His Soul. As recent recipients of funding from NZ on air\, you can expect for the next single\, Red Day\, to be released in early 2025. \nJoin Sea Mouse at the Darkroom in Christchurch on Saturday 23rd November 2024 \nMade up of Seamus Johnson (Guitar and Vocals)\, Scott Maynard (Bass)\, and Thomas Friggens (Drums)\, Sea Mouse formed in 2017 and quickly set about shaking up the local music scene. Creating a unique blend of sounds from the Delta blues of the 1930s\, to mammoth guitar-driven garage rock tunes\, coupled with a mesmerising live show\, Sea Mouse has gone from strength to strength and this is only the beginning! \nDon’t sleep on Sea Mouse! DESCRIPTION:New Zealand-based dream pop/shoegaze DIY recording artist YOUNG MOON is embarking on a highly anticipated SLOW TOUR in August 2024\, taking their energetic and dynamic live performance across Aotearoa. \nTrevor Montgomery\, formerly of TARENTEL & LAZARUS\, has been writing and recording brooding ballads and blissful psychedelia as YOUNG MOON for over a decade. \nUtilizing vintage drum machines and atmospheric synths\, Montgomery has a talent for lo-fi tracks with genuine\nlyrics exploring love\, life\, and death. \nSan Francisco ex-pat\, Montgomery now calls Whakatū (Nelson) home. He continues to write and record with YOUNG MOON – now transformed into a full live band experience with close friends from the Te Tau Ihu music community. \nYOUNG MOON will showcase material from the band’s full back-catalog. This includes the albums Navigated Like the Swan (2012) and Colt (2016)\, and the stunning 2023 Orindal Records release Triggered by Sunsets. \nTour Guest: \nTe Whanganui-a-Tara singer and DIY recording artist TIMOTHY BLACKMAN makes records drawing from deeply personal experiences in hyper realistic narratives. \nIn 2019 he released Brightest Days\, his first album in eight years\, written during a period of time spent hiding out on the East Cape. Scoop up an early bird before they’re gone! \n  \nAbout Dirtyphonics: \nParisian electronic duo Dirtyphonics (Charly Barranger and Julien ‘Pitchin’ Corrales) are true legends of Bass Music. They have shaped the sound of French Bass Music and have taken their boundless creativity and explosive shows all across the world\, from Coachella to Tomorrowland\, Glastonbury and many more. After countless releases on multiple labels\, and remixes for Skrillex\, The Chainsmokers\, Marylin Manson\, Linking Park\, Kaskade and many others\, Dirtyphonics have joined the Monstercat records family to release a string of heavy music going from the iconic metal infused “Vantablack EP” with Sullivan King to the intense “Evil Inside” that gathered millions on Spotify. \nIn 2022\, Dirtyphonics have stepped up to their role of ambassador of the French Bass Music by helping and pushing established and up coming French producers to the limelight. They did so on their “What The French” EP\, a collaborative body of work that lays the grounds of what French Bass music sounds like. After headlining festivals all over Europe in 2022 and 2023 with their large scale production “LIIVE” and “Elevated” tours\, Dirtyphonics released in May 2024 their long awaited sophomore album\, “Magnetic”\, that displays once again their love for Drum & Bass and their ability to navigate across multiple tempos. The guys are now embarking on a world tour that will take them from Tomorrowland\, Parookaville and Dreambeach to Lost Lands and many more. \n
